Engine & Transmission
The Subaru Forester boasts a powerful 150-hp engine paired with standard all-wheel drive for confident handling. Its boxer engine layout and multi-port fuel injection system contribute to its responsive performance.
Specs
-
Rating
Powertrain Architecture
Internal Combustion engine
Power
150 Hp @ 6000 rpm.
Power Per Litre
75.2 Hp/l
Torque
198 Nm @ 4200 rpm. 146.04 lb.-ft. @ 4200 rpm.
Engine Layout
Front, Longitudinal
Engine Displacement
1995 cm3 121.74 cu. in.
Number Of Cylinders
4
Engine Configuration
Boxer
Number Of Valves Per Cylinder
4
Fuel Injection System
Multi-port manifold injection
Engine Aspiration
Naturally aspirated engine
Valvetrain
DOHC
Engine Oil Capacity
4.2 l 4.44 US qt | 3.7 UK qt
Engine Oil Specification
5W-30 / ILSAC GF-4, ILSAC GF-5
Drive Wheel
All wheel drive (4x4)
Number Of Gears And Type Of Gearbox
4 gears, automatic transmission

Weight & Capacity
The Subaru Forester has a weight-to-power ratio of 10 kg/Hp (100.3 Hp/tonne) and a weight-to-torque ratio of 7.6 kg/Nm (132.4 Nm/tonne). It has a kerb weight of 1495 kg (3295.91 lbs.) and a minimum trunk/boot space of 450 l (15.89 cu. ft.).
Specs
-
Rating
Weight To Power Ratio
10 kg/Hp, 100.3 Hp/tonne
Weight To Torque Ratio
7.6 kg/Nm, 132.4 Nm/tonne
Kerb Weight
1495 kg 3295.91 lbs.
Trunk Boot Space Minimum
450 l 15.89 cu. ft.
